New Task/Milestone Shape and Text Label Selection Rules for OnePager 7.0

From OnePager Documentation
Revision as of 16:35, 13 December 2019 by Rfeingold (Talk | contribs) (Selecting Task Shapes versus Selecting Task Shape Text Labels)

Jump to: navigation, search

New Task/Milestone Shape and Text Label Selection Rules for OnePager 7.0 (0.4.2.3-70)

Overview

1) As part of the Smart Task/Milestone Text Labeling feature's implementation in OnePager 7.0, we changed the rules for task shape and text label manual left-click and right-click selection to facilitate the addition of The Smart Task/Milestone Text Label Collision Avoidance Feature.

2) These changes are as follows:

Left-Click Selection Rules

3) To select a task/milestone shape in OnePager 7.0 you left-click the task shape itself.

4) To select the task/milestone shape's text label left-click the text label only.

Right-Click Selection Rules

5) A right-click on a task/milestone shape accesses a context menu with commands that are associated with edits to the task/milestone shape itself.

6) A right-click on a text label accesses a specific context menu tailored with commands that are for edits to the text label.

7) When a set of task/milestone shapes and their associated text labels are in a text label collision situation, a right-click on the tasks/milestone shape accesses the context menu augmented with a command to invoke the text label collision avoidance algorithm.

Select Associated Text

8) Since these new rules represents a change from previous versions of OnePager with respect to selecting task/milestone shapes and their text labels,

9) OnePager 7.0 provides an option for setting the behavior of task/milestone shape selection to that of previous versions.

10) This option is controlled by a checkbox in the Advanced tab of the Template and Chart Properties forms in the Display options control group called Select associated text.

11) The default setting in the checkbox is checked OFF.

12) Checking this checkbox On changes the behavior of a left-click on a task/milestone shape such that the left-click selects both the task/milestone shape and the text label.

13) Regardless of the setting in the Select associated text checkbox, there is no difference in how the right-click on a task/milestone shape and/or text label operates.

14) Examples and illustrations are provided in the section below.

Changes to Task Shape and Text Label Right-Click Context Menus

15) The changes to task/milestone shape and text label selection described above offers an opportunity to simplify the context menus associated with task/milestone shapes and text labels.

16) The right-click on task/milestone shape context menu contains commands available in previous versions of OnePager with the addition of a new command associated with the Smart Task/Milestone Text Labeling feature - the Re-optimize text collisions for the selected task/milestones command.

17) This new context menu command is explained in greater detail in the Wiki articles referenced below.

18) The right click on a text label has a simplified context menu of two commands that allows you to edit the text label name and to access the Change Task/Milestone Properties form at the Task Label tab.

19) As in previous OnePager versions this form allows you to turn the display of text labels On and Off, change their positions relative to their task/milestone shape, and change their font properties.

Selecting Task Shapes versus Selecting Task Shape Text Labels

1) Editing task/milestone shapes and task/milestone text labels changed in OnePager 7.0. In this context we are specifically addressing task/milestone name text labels.

2) With respect to left-click selection in OnePager 7.0, a left-click on the task/milestone shape selects and highlights only the task/milestone shape.

File:P70-0 4 2 3-70-(9A)-06122019.png
P70-0_4_2_3-70-(9A)-06122019.png

3) A left-click on the text label selects and highlights only the text label.

File:P70-0 4 2 3-70-(9B)-06122019.png
P70-0_4_2_3-70-(9B)-06122019.png

4) Right-clicking the task/milestone shape accesses the task/milestone shape context menu as shown below:

File:P70-0 4 2 3-70-(9)-06122019.png
P70-0_4_2_3-70-(9)-06122019.png

5) Right-clicking on the task/milestone text label accesses the text label context menu as shown below:

File:P70-0 4 2 3-70-(10)-06122019.png
P70-0_4_2_3-70-(10)-06122019.png

6) For the task/milestone shape context menu, the commands behave exactly the same as in previous versions of OnePager.

7) For the task/milestone text label context menu, there are two commands in the context menu:

a) Edit task name… or
b) Format… to access the Change Task/Milestone Properties form at the Task Label tab.

8) The Edit task name… and the Format… commands both behave as in previous versions of OnePager when selected with a right-click in the text label.

9) Please see this article for more information: Changing Individual Task/Milestone Properties (Color, Shapes, Labels, etc.) 9.2.1-70.

Making the Task/Milestone Shape Left-Click Selection Select Both the Task Shape and Text Label in One Left Click

10) OnePager 7.0 provides a control for you to change the response that a left-click on a task/milestone shape allowing a single click on the task/milestone shape to select both the task/milestone shape and its corresponding text label.

11) The control is called the Select associated text checkbox and is found in the Template and Chart Properties form’s Advanced tab in the Display options control group as shown below for the Chart Properties form:

File:P70-0 4 2 3-70-(11)-06122019.png
P70-0_4_2_3-70-(11)-06122019.png

12) If you mouse over this checkbox the following tool tip appears: When the task/milestone shape is selected, also select all text associated with the shape, including the task name, dates, and percent complete labels.

13) As with all tool tips they are provided to assist you in determining what the control basically does.

14) As an example, the illustration below is a chart portion where there was a left-click on the task/milestone shape only when the Select associated text checkbox is checked Off.

P70-0 4 2 3-70-(12)-06122019.png
P70-0_4_2_3-70-(12)-06122019.png
a) Left-clicking the task/milestone shape only selects the task shape as shown above.
b) When the task/milestone shape is selected in the above example, only the Icons on the Home tool bar tab that are applicable to editing task/milestone shapes are enabled. The enabled control groups are: Editing, Settings, Font, and Format.
c) Even with the Select associated text checkbox checked Off, left-clicks on the task/milestone shape still allow you to change Font properties but not text label position.
d) You can change text label alignment if the text label is configured such that text label alignment changes are available.
e) However, in the situation described above, where one or more task/milestone shapes are left-clicked with the Select associated text checkbox checked Off, you can right-click on any of the selected task/milestone shape to access its normal context menu.
f) And, you can use all the commands in the context menu as well as all the tabs available in the Change Task/Milestone Properties form accessed from the Format… command in the context menu.
g) Additionally, you can access the Change Task/Milestone Properties form by clicking the Format… Icon on the Home tool bar tab as shown below:
File:P70-0 4 2 3-70-(13)-06122019.png
P70-0_4_2_3-70-(13)-06122019.png

15) To complete the example, the illustration below is a chart portion where the Select associated text checkbox is checked On, and the task/milestone shape is selected with a left-click:

P70-0 4 2 3-70-(14)-06122019.png
P70-0_4_2_3-70-(14)-06122019.png
a) With the Select associated text checkbox checked On, a left-click on the task/milestone shape selects the task shape and its text label as shown above.
b) When the task/milestone shape and text label are selected as in the above example, ALL Icons on the Home tool bar tab that are applicable to editing task/milestone shapes and text labels are enabled.
c) The applicable control groups are: Editing, Settings, Font, Format, and Position.
d) The Alignment control group is only enabled if there is an option available to re-align the text label or text labels for selected items.
e) Essentially, checking the Select associated text checkbox ON makes the OnePager 7.0 behavior relative to left-clicking of task/milestone shapes or text labels operate the same as left-clicking only the task/milestone shape in previous versions of OnePager.
f) You can right-click on either the task/milestone shape or text label in this situation and the appropriate context menu is accessed.
g) All associated commands operate as documented including gaining access to the Change Task/Milestone Properties form.

16) OnePager 7.0, regardless of the status of the Select associated text status of checked On or checked Off, permits you to right-click on any previously selected task/milestone shape or text label and accesses any of the context menu commands.

Related Links

Editing with the Chart Properties form (Portal) 21.0.1-70

Modifying Decorations on Tasks/Milestones (Portal) 10.0.1-70

Task/Milestone Text Labels for OnePager Pro 10.15.1.-70

Task/Milestone Text Labels for OnePager Express 10.16.1.-70

Labeling Task/Milestone Dates for OnePager Pro 10.1.1-70

Labeling Task/Milestone Dates for OnePager Express 10.2.1-70

Percent complete for OnePager Pro 10.3.1-70

Percent complete for OnePager Express 10.4.1-70

Order of Tasks/Milestones Decorations 10.13.1-70

Task Bars Tab for OnePager Pro 21.3.1-70

Task Bars Tab for OnePager Express 21.4.1-70

Milestones Tab for OnePager Pro 21.5.1-70

Milestones Tab for OnePager Express 21.6.1-70

(0.4.2.3-70)